Calvin's Catechism
A reformulation of the Genevan
Catechism.
In 1560 Calvin Published a reformulation of
the Geneva Catechism which had been used to train and catechize
families. The republished catechism is in the form of a dialogue
between a Minister of the Gospel and a young man, or as Calvin says,
"a child." I am persuaded that not many children today
would go very far in the conversation Calvin is holding with this
"child."
The catechism is excellent. Those who
hold to its doctrine will be quite proficient in religion.
